    I don't think I've seen it mentioned on here & it may be worth it for LOTS of us who don't live near an Asda.

    Asda have a delivery saver - cost is just £5 for a WHOLE MONTH - as many deliveries as you want - limited to 1 a day. The amount you have to order is a minimum of £25 a time. It'll be £8 a month after 13th September

    There is also a code for £10 off a first £50 shop or £20 off a £100 one on MSM until tonight. Don't forget to refer a friend to also get an extra £10 each cashback ALTHOUGH I'm damned if I could find anywhere to put this at checkout! I've written to MSM about this so live in hope!

    As we have about a 14 mile round trip to Asda this makes sense to me. I can partake of all the glitches/cashbacks and still get an APG and cashback - we quite often spend around this figure - £25 -knowing that with cashback & APG we've spent a fraction of the figure. Also quite often stuff is OOS in our shop but the deliveries come from another store and in the past we've been pretty lucky that we've had delivered just about everything. You can always send back if they substitute!

    I've just done a £50+ shop. Got £10 off 1st order, should get an APG for £16 and £7+ CB - net cost to me £17ish + £5 for a months delivery - you ALSO get the delivery costs back for ALL shops up to £25 a person from MSM. Bit of a no-brainer!
